FREE school meals will be easier to obtain in Dorset, thanks to a new application process.
Dorset County Council fears that many children may be missing out on the benefit of school meals because parents find the application process difficult.
From now on, applications will be dealt with in 24 hours and parents will not need to re-apply each successive year.
“Our continued drive to make services more efficient now means that parents will only apply once to register for free school meals and they can be reassured that the process will be much quicker, allowing their children to benefit much earlier,” said cabinet member for children and young people, Toni Coombs.
